New promising Dreamcast emu

Well, I've been betatesting a friend's DC emulator (no name yet, still in very early alpha). Recently he added sound emulation and some fixes, making some nice progress overall. Some homebrew games are playble as of now (DCQuad, Doom4DC), many boot (DCQuake).

BIOS shows the swirl, and plays some sound, unfortunately it seems there is a bug in SH4 core, making rest of the BIOS screens painfully slow.
